Sachem Capital Description
Sachem Capital Corp is a United States-based real estate investment trust. The company specializes in originating, underwriting, funding, servicing, and managing a portfolio of short-term loans secured by first mortgage liens on real property located in Connecticut. Its primary objective is to grow the loan portfolio while protecting and preserving capital in a manner that provides for attractive risk-adjusted returns to shareholders over the long term through dividends. |
